About the Book

Principles of Developmental Movement is a comprehensive, fully-illustrated guide to bodily awareness and control based on the study of infant development.

The stages by which a child learns to achieve upright posture and the full range of motor skills is a remarkable journey of learning and discovery. Each stage of development represents a critical advance in function from the most primitive to the most advanced forms of balance and locomotion. As adults, studying these developmental movements--whether lying prone, crawling on all fours, or clambering onto a table-opens a window onto our design and function.

In Principles of Developmental Movement, Dimon examines key developmental sequences and reveals what these can tell us about how to move effortlessly and function more efficiently. By exploring each one, we can effect improvements in the working of the muscular system, gain insight into how to move more efficiently, and progress from infantile to more advanced forms of balance and support-becoming, in the process, more conscious and aware in everything we do.

About the Author :
Dr. Theodore Dimon is director of the Dimon Institute, a founding director of the American Society of Teachers of the Alexander Technique, and a widely recognized expert in the Alexander Technique. Ted holds a Masters degree and Doctorate in Education from Harvard University and has lectured as an adjunct professor of clinical psychology and education at Columbia University Teachers College. His publications include The Undivided Self, The Elements of Skill, The Body in Motion, and Anatomy of the Voice.
